提供一种用于有效地对加扰的内容进行定位的方法和设备。该方法包括:检查构成所述内容的包的节目映射表(PMT)包的定位信息,所述定位信息用于对所述内容的变换部分进行定位;从PMT包的定位信息中提取包含用于对所述内容的变换部分进行定位的定位数据的下一PMT包的位置信息;以及通过使用由提取的位置信息所指示的下一PMT包中的定位数据来对所述内容的变换部分进行定位。因此,能够容易地检测存储定位信息的内容的位置,从而加速变换的内容的定位。
【技术实现步骤摘要】
与本专利技术一致的方法和设备涉及恢复内容,更具体地说,本专利技术的一方面涉及用于有效对内容的变换部分进行定位的方法和设备。
技术介绍
用于作为下一代光盘保护系统的AACS (高级访问内容系统)的标准使用广播加密方案,其不允许具有由于黑客攻击等而撤销的装置密钥集的播放器对根据该广播加密方案加密的内容进行解密。在广播加密方案中,将不同的装置密钥集分配给每ー播放器,使用撤销的装置密钥集的加密的中间密钥没有被存储在向公众发布的盘中,从而防止具有撤销的装置密钥集的播放器获得中间密钥。因此,具有撤销的装置密钥集的播放器无法获得内容解密密钥。然而,即使未公开装置密钥集,也可基于特定播放器模型的结构缺陷来创建黑客软件。在此情况下,可通过黑客软件对大量播放器进行黑客攻击,因此,为了解决该问题,不能撤销分配给被黑客攻击的播放器的所有装置密钥集。为了解决该问题,已经提出个人内容可恢复性方案来通过使用用于每ー内容的可编程代码来控制恢复内容。在可恢复性方案中,在盘中存储控制内容的恢复的安全码。在再现内容之前执行安全码,从而确定在再现内容中是否存在问题。例如,确定是否已公开播放器的装置密钥集或是否安装或正在运行黑客软件。其后,仅当确定在内容再现处理中没有问题时才恢复内容。换句话说,难以对已售播放器进行升级,但可通过在盘上存储安全码在内容级别对盘进行升级。图I是传统媒体播放器I的框图。參照图I,传统媒体播放器I包括媒体接ロ 11、虚拟机12、存储器13、解密/解码单元14和输出接ロ 15。媒体接ロ 11从诸如数字视频盘(DVD)和致密盘(⑶)的介质中读取作为保护内容的程序的安全码。虚拟机12执行通过媒体接ロ 11读取的安全码以生成媒体播放器I的信息,并对生成的信息和已存储在存储器13中的媒体播放器I的信息进行比较。接下来,虚拟机12基于比较结果来确定是否已经公开媒体播放器I的装置密钥集或是否安装或正在运行黑客软件,并仅当确定尚未公开媒体播放器I的装置密钥集或未安装或运行黑客软件时才进一步执行安全码以生成用于控制内容恢复的信息。解密/解码单元14通过使用由虚拟机12生成的信息来对由媒体接ロ 11读取的内容进行解密和解码。如果根据诸如CSS标准或AACS标准的内容保护标准对内容进行加密,则解密/解码单元14根据用于对内容加密的内容保护标准对由媒体接ロ 11读取的内容进行解密。如果根据MPEG-2对内容编码,则根据MPEG-2对内容解码。输出接ロ 15将由解密/解码单元14解密和解码的内容输出到诸如数字电视(DTV)的显示装置。如上所述,传统的个人内容可恢复性方案提供一种根据是否已经公开媒体播放器的装置密钥集或媒体播放器的安全环境是否正常来控制内容恢复的解决方案。然而,传统的个人内容可恢复性方案不提供例如在整个内容再现中保护内容不受到黑客的频繁攻击的解决方案。
技术实现思路
本专利技术的一方面提供一种用于有效地对变换的内容进行定位以保护其在整个内容再现中不受到黑客的频繁攻击的设备和方法。本专利技术的一方面还提供一种在其上记录用于执行上述方法的计算机程序的计算机可读介质。根据本专利技术的一方面,提供ー种对内容进行定位的方法,该方法包括检查构成所述内容的包的第一包的定位信息,所述定位信息被用于对所述内容的变换部分进行定位;从检查的第一包的定位信息中提取所述包的第二包的位置信息,所述第二包包含用于对所述内容的变换部分进行定位的定位数据;以及通过使用由提取的位置信息所指示的第二包中的定位数据来对所述内容的变换部分进行定位。根据本专利技术的另一方面,提供一种在其上记录用于执行上述方法的计算机程序的计算机可读介质。根据本专利技术的另一方面,提供ー种对内容进行定位的设备,该设备包括检查单元,检查构成所述内容的包的第一包的定位信息,并从检查的第一包的定位信息中提取所述包的第二包的位置信息,其中,所述定位信息被用于对所述内容的变换部分进行定位,所述第二包包含用于对所述内容的变换部分进行定位的定位数据;以及定位単元,基于由检查单元检查的第一包的定位信息来选择性地对所述内容的变换部分进行定位。附图说明通过參照附图对本专利技术的示例性实施例进行的详细描述,本专利技术的上述和其它方面和优点将变得更加清楚,其中图I是示出传统媒体播放器的框图;图2是示出根据本专利技术实施例的内容保护方法的示图;图3是根据本专利技术实施例的媒体播放器的框图;图4是示出根据本专利技术实施例的检查定位信息的处理的示图;以及图5和图6是示出根据本专利技术实施例的恢复内容的方法的流程图。具体实施例方式以下将參照附图详细描述根据本专利技术的示例性实施例。图2是示出根据本专利技术实施例的内容保护方法的示图。如上所述,传统的个人内容可更新性方案在整个内容再现中不提供例如保护内容不受到黑客的频繁攻击的解决方案。因此,例如很可能仅通过使用简单的遥控操作就容易、地禁用例如数字视频盘(DVD)的区域码。具体地说,当通过使用少量简单控制命令来控制内容恢复时,在内容再现的开始阶段期间可仅以很少的攻击来禁用传统的个人内容可再现性方案。为了防止该问题,根据本专利技术实施例,对内容进行加扰以对其进行变换,对加扰的内容进行解扰所需的多条信息彼此独立,并将安全码设计为包含所述多条信息。因此,连续使用安全码来对加扰的内容进行解扰。然而,根据系统的规格,对整个内容加扰可能增加系统的负担。因此,根据本专利技术实施例,如图2所示,对内容的某些独立的部分进行加扰来变换内容,从而充分防止用户观看该内容。可通过使用各种方法来对通过加扰而变换的部分内容进行定位。首先,在安全码中包含对内容的变换部分进行定位所需的各种信息。在此情 况下,由于在安全码中包含大量数据,因此,在需要连续执行安全码来再现内容的环境中,系统的负担显著增加。其次,对内容的变换部分进行定位所需的部分信息包含在安全码中,大部分信息包含在该内容中。在此情况下,容易地确定内容的哪一部分存储用于对内容的变换部分进行定位的信息是很重要的。因此,在本专利技术的实施例中,在根据运动图像专家组(MPEG)-2的节目映射表(PMT)包的保留区域中存储用于对内容的变换部分进行定位的信息。然而,本领域技术人员应理解,可使用除了 PMT包之外的各种类型的包来存储所述信息。再者,将标志插入包含用于充分对内容的变换部分进行定位的信息的PMT包,从而区分PMT包和普通包。然而,在此情况下,必须对所有包进行解析以检测包含用于对内容的变换部分进行定位的信息的PMT包。为了解决该问题,在本专利技术的实施例中,将包含用于对内容的变换部分进行定位的信息的下一 PMT包的位置信息插入PMT包。图3是根据本专利技术实施例的媒体播放器3的框图。參照图3,媒体播放器3包括媒体接ロ 31、虚拟机32、存储器33、解密单元34、检查单元35、定位单元36、解码单元37以及输出接ロ 38。媒体接ロ 31从诸如DVD或致密盘(CD)的介质读取内容和作为用于保护内容的程序的安全码。此外,媒体接ロ 31可临时支持存储内容以匹配解密单元34的解密速度或解码单元37的解码速度。在本专利技术实施例中,内容的典型示例是根据MPEG-2进行编码的视听(AV)标题。此夕卜,可根据各种方法来保护内容。例如,可通过使用根据内容加扰系统(CSS)标准的CSS密钥或通过使用根据高级访问内容系统(AACS)标准的标题本文档来自技高网...
【技术保护点】
【技术特征摘要】
2006.07.12 KR 10-2006-0065179;2005.07.19 US 60/7001.ー种对内容进行定位的方法,包括 检查构成内容的包的第一包的定位信息,并确定定位信息是否包括定位数据; 如果定位信息包括定位数据,则提取定位数据以对内容...
【专利技术属性】
技术研发人员:刘容国,郑铉权,慎峻范,崔允镐,南秀铉,
申请(专利权)人:三星电子株式会社,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。